Must read: Wealthy right-wingers finance anti-Dem effort

by Francine Busby

For so many of us who worked to get Obama elected, it is difficult to watch his enemies tearing at all his programs and initiatives and creating divsiveness and hatred at every turn.

This article from the New Yorker is a must read because it explains the billions of dollars that have gone into this effort by the Koch brothers. It is a gut-wrenching expose of these far-right brothers who have built an empire of research institutes, non-profits and grassroots organizations that have undermined truth, environmental progress and the well-being of hard-working Amerincas at every turn in support of their twisted ideology and greed.

Please take the time to read it and share it. Here is the link:
“Covert Operation: The Billionaire Brothers Who Are Waging War Against Obama”
http://www.newyorker.com/reporting/2010/08/30/100830fa_fact_mayer

One reason that it is so important for us here is that their Americans for Prosperity Group is the same group that kicked on Brian Bilbray’s campaign on August 12 in Solana Beach. In addition to all the information in this article, they are also conncected to Tobacco. As you know, Bilbray also started the Congressional Cigar Association as a front for the Tobacco industry to access Congressional staffers. He also voted in favor of Tobaaco’s legislative priority when he voted against extending the SChip program for Children’s Healthc are to our most vulnerable children.

Please share this message with all those who worked so hard to elect Barack Obama. Although we can’t match the Koch Brothers billions, we can at least fight their influence here in our district by defeating their candidate. As you’ll see in the article, they are putting $45 million into races across the country through their Americans for Prosperity organization.
